#1e0e41 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e0e41 is composed of 11.8% red, 5.5%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 74.5% black. It has a hue angle of 258.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.6% and a lightness of 15.5%. #1e0e41 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c1c82 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#1e0e41 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e0e41 has RGB values of R:30, G:14,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 1969729.
